“PART VAARRESTMENT IN EXECUTION
Certificate of execution69A.
A certificate of execution of an arrestment in execution shall be in Form 63B.
Service of final decree69B.
The copy final decree served under section 73C(2)4 of the Act (arrestment on the dependence followed by decree) shall be in Form 63C.Failure to disclose information69C.
(1)
An application under section 73H(1)5 of the Act (failure to disclose information)–(a)
shall be in Form 63D; and
(b)
must be intimated by the creditor to the debtor and to the arrestee.
(2)
On the lodging of an application under paragraph (1) the sheriff may–
(a)
fix a date for a hearing; and
(b)
order the sheriff clerk to intimate the date of the hearing in Form 63E to such persons as the sheriff considers appropriate.
Notice of objection69D.
(1)
A notice of objection under section 73M6 of the Act (notice of objection) shall be in Form 63F.(2)
On the lodging of a notice of objection under paragraph (1) the sheriff must–
(a)
fix a date for the hearing; and
(b)
order the sheriff clerk to intimate the date of the hearing in Form 63E to such persons as the sheriff considers appropriate.
Application for release of property where arrestment unduly harsh69E.
(1)
An application under section 73Q(2)7 of the Act (application for release of property where arrestment unduly harsh) shall be in Form 63G.(2)
On the lodging of an application under paragraph (1) the sheriff must–
(a)
fix a date for the hearing of the Act; and
(b)
order the sheriff clerk to intimate the date of the hearing in Form 63E to such persons as the sheriff considers appropriate.
Power of sheriff to make orders69F.
The sheriff may make such other order for the progress of an application under this Part as he considers appropriate in the circumstances of the case.
Service of documents69G.
Rules 5.3 to 5.6 of the Ordinary Cause Rules in the First Schedule to the Sheriff Courts (Scotland) Act 19078 are to apply to the service or intimation of any document under this Part as they apply to the service or intimation of any document under those Rules.”.

“22.
(1)
Before making an order under section 33(4)(b) or (c) the sheriff shall–
(a)
order representations to be lodged by the persons mentioned in section 33(7)(a)28 within such period as he considers appropriate; or(b)
fix a date for a hearing.
(2)
The sheriff clerk shall intimate any order of the sheriff under paragraph (1) to the persons mentioned in section 33(7)(a) and to the officer of court who prepared the report of the auction.
(3)
Where the sheriff makes an order under section 33(4)(b) or (c) the sheriff clerk shall intimate it to the officer of court who prepared the report of the auction.”.
